After my teeth were extracted they won't stop bleeding, what can i do?

A doctor has provided 1 answer

Still bleeding: Assuming you have no bleeding or clotting issues: after an extraction the gum tissues can ooze for some time. Bite down on the gauze the dds gave you, putting pressure on the extraction site. Leave it undisturbed for at least 30 minutes. Change gauze, repeat for another 30 mins. If that doesn't work, take a tea bag, wet it and squeeze it, wrap in gauze and bite down, that should stop it.
